DuPont Pioneer needed a 21st century laboratory space that included cold rooms, culture rooms, and entomology rooms. This need was satisfied by building the Reid "E" Laboratory/Office Building which also included highly flexible office space to support the laboratories. Baker Group design engineers thought outside the box for design of the innovative environmental chambers. A central chiller plant was also installed to support existing and future laboratory buildings. Features of the facility's mechanical systems include:
Custom Environmental Chamber
- Entomology Area
- Rear Rooms (55 degrees F night, 85 degrees F day)
- Cage Rooms (80 - 85 degrees F @ 100% R.H.)
- Hatching Room (55 degrees F)
- Cold Rooms - 4 degree C room plus/minus 1 degree C anywhere
- Light Culture Rooms - 26 degrees C plus/minus 1 degree C anywhere
- Dark Culture Rooms - 26 degree C plus/minus 1 degree C anywhere
- Centralized low temperature process cooling plant
- Integrate temperature control with BAS system
- 30% savings compared to traditional environmental chamber designs
Piping Systems
- Natural gas, compressed air and vacuum gases piped to each laboratory and fume hoods
- Continuously available condenser water system
- Chilled water plant combining chillers from three separate buildings
- Low temperature chilled water
- D. I. and R. O. Systems
Heat Recovery
- Air to water system - provides a 30% reduction in heating energy
Air Handling System
- Single pass system
- Three stages of filtration
- Reclaim, heating and chilled water coils
- Steam humidification
Exhaust Air System
- Strobic exhaust fans
- S. S. duct construction
- Fume hood VAV control, continuous monitoring of face velocity
